Output 9ebf5a37490453d6292a85fecbe3f23d7e06e9a774eaa60e64727059f9b746e2:18

value
12070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d97a57cf0c44969b1f2f0934b21b50caa363a1a OP_EQUALVERIFY OP_CHECKSIG
address
1DufwdPEUcmn5JPibK5rtrry4M78XC23xG
transaction
9ebf5a37490453d6292a85fecbe3f23d7e06e9a774eaa60e64727059f9b746e2
spent
true